St. Clement Current Funds supported by our parishioners and benefactors:
1. Offertory (maintains the running of the parish and the completion of our mission to evangelize)
2. Annual Pastoral Appeal (supports our communal missionary efforts as a Diocese)
3. Renovation Fund (maintains the upkeep and renovations of our parish buildings)
4. Debt Reduction (seeks to retire the debt on the church and priest's residence)
5. St. Clement Education Facility and Activity Center Building Fund (a savings program that seeks
to put aside funds for a future education building, gym, and youth and activity center)
6. Hispanic Apostolate/Migrant Ministry (seeks to provide for the spiritual and material needs of
our Hispanic and Migrant brothers and sisters)
7. Seminarian Fund (supports parish seminarians and parish vocation programs)
8. Special Collection for: Pregnancy Care Center (taken up on Mother's Day for the support
of our local pregnancy care center)
9. Special Collection for: My Brother's Keeper (taken up on Father's Day and at our Thanksgiving Day Masses for the support of our food for the needy ministry)
